#6d50cd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6d50cd is composed of 42.7% red, 31.4%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 46.8% cyan, 61%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 253.9 degrees, a saturation of 55.6% and a lightness of 55.9%. #6d50cd color hex could be obtained by blending #daa0ff with #00009b.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

#6d50cd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#6d50cd has RGB values of R:109, G:80, B:205 and CMYK values of C:0.47, M:0.61, Y:0,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 7164109.

Shades and Tints of #6d50cd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040208 is the darkest color, while #f9f8f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#6d50cd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d8d90 is the less saturated color, while #5625f8 is the most saturated one.
